Management Commentary

During the accompanying public earnings discussion, Global’s leadership focused primarily on operational priorities rather than detailed financial performance metrics, given the lack of disclosed revenue data. Management highlighted ongoing efforts to upgrade aging water and wastewater infrastructure across the company’s regional service footprint, noting that these investments are core to maintaining compliance with state and federal environmental regulations and long-term service reliability for its residential and commercial customer base. Leadership also acknowledged that persistent inflationary pressure on labor, construction materials, and utility input costs contributed to the modest per-share loss recorded for the quarter, noting that these cost headwinds have been a consistent trend for the sector in recent months. No additional commentary on revenue trends, customer count changes, or margin breakdowns was shared during the public portion of the earnings release, per the official filed documents. Forward Guidance

Global did not release specific quantitative forward guidance for revenue, EPS, or total capital expenditure totals in its the previous quarter earnings filing, but leadership did share high-level qualitative outlook points. Management noted that it will continue to pursue regulatory rate adjustment requests across its service areas in the upcoming months, which could potentially offset a portion of ongoing cost pressures if approved by local regulatory bodies. The company also stated that it intends to keep infrastructure investment as its top capital allocation priority, which may possibly lead to continued near-term cost pressure until corresponding rate adjustments are approved and implemented. Leadership also noted that future earnings releases may include additional financial metrics, including revenue figures, but no formal timeline for expanded disclosure was shared during the announcement. All forward-looking statements shared by management are subject to risks including regulatory approval delays, unforeseen emergency infrastructure maintenance costs, and broader macroeconomic volatility, per standard risk disclosures included in the filing.
